EVgo Expands Fast Charging Network at US Grocery Stores

WHY IT MATTERS

This expansion aims to increase access to fast charging for electric vehicle owners, making long-distance travel more practical and reducing range anxiety.

What happened

EVgo is expanding its fast-charging network by adding more than 400 fast-charging stalls at grocery-anchored shopping centers across the US. This move aims to provide EV drivers with convenient charging options while they shop or grab a coffee. The expansion is part of EVgo's efforts to increase access to fast charging for electric vehicle owners. The company is targeting grocery-anchored shopping centers, which are often located near residential areas and offer a convenient location for EV drivers to charge their vehicles. By integrating charging stations into these shopping centers, EVgo is creating a seamless experience for EV owners who need to charge their vehicles while running errands. The exact locations of the new charging stations have not been disclosed, but EVgo plans to announce them in the coming weeks.
